Telchar, the Essential, and the Obscure (Volume 17, Issue 10)

In The Silmarillion, Tolkien describes the work of the Ainur as encompassing "the immeasurable vastness of the World" but also "the minute precision to which they shape all things therein." He could be describing his own legendarium, which includes events so large that the alter the shape of the world alongside the kinds of details that might be classified as obscure but on which consideration was clearly spent.

This month's character of the month, Telchar of Nogrod, illustrates where the essential and the obscure overlap. Telchar is the artificer of several objects without which the story of Middle-earth would be altered: the Dragon-helm of Dor-lómin, Angrist, Narsil. Yet Telchar himself is obscure. Tolkien wrote very little about him and never fully settled on the details of his character. 

Lindariel's biography of Telchar unearths what little we do know of him but delves also into the crafts for which he is renowned and about which we know much more. She also explores the textual history of Telchar's character and how he evolved across decades during which he was present in the legendarium, serving as a somewhat mysterious person to whom Dwarven masterpieces could be attributed. "Tolkien's pattern with all three known works of Telchar," she writes, "was first to imagine the work, and only later to attribute it to Telchar." In this way, Telchar becomes an essential figure within Tolkien's own creative process: a catchall craftsman whose masterpieces usher in some of Middle-earth's most pivotal moments.

Mr. Popularity Gets His Month in the Spotlight (Volume 17, Issue 6)

Fifteen years ago this July, the SWG ran an event called Seven in '07 in honor of the House of Fëanor. As part of it, each member of the House was given a short biography "illustrated" with fanworks. This project was a precursor to our Character of the Month, which would begin just a few months later.

However, since the Fëanorians were done, we didn't include them in the Character of the Month column. As Oshun pushed the Character of the Month into more and more detailed territory, however, those original Seven in '07 biographies began to seem inadequate, especially for characters as influential in the texts—and the fandom—as the Fëanorians. We've been working to replace them, and this month, after almost fifteen years, Maedhros finally gets his moment in the spotlight.

Maedhros is one of the fandom's favorite—and most controversial—characters. Fan interpretations run the gamut from seeing him as an innocent victim of his circumstances to an evil architect of the horrors of the First Age. This month's biography is the first of two parts and looks at his early life, up to the turning point marked by his captivity by Melkor. During this time, he was pulled between two brilliant parents: the impetuous and rebellious Fëanor and the patient and thoughtful Nerdanel. As the eldest son, he was a leader in his house, and his choices in these early years show the influence of Fëanor and Nerdanel, the first driving him to the disastrous oath but the latter shaping how he would respond to political and familial conflicts across the centuries as the head of his house.

Oshun's biography of Maedhros covers his early life, until his captivity by Melkor: the influence of the oath, his parents, and the ultimate development of his leadership role among the Noldorin princes. Becoming Bookverse (Volume 17, Issue 5)

"The world has changed." With these words, the Fellowship of the Ring film opens. Yes, of course, it is describing a world darkened by the presence of the One Ring. But for Tolkien fans, this line could have just as easily described their fandom communities, which were undergoing massive transformations due to the rise of home Internet use, changes in the Internet landscape, and of course, the films.

This month, in our Cultus Dispatches column, we offer the first in what will be a series of articles about the impact of the two Jackson film trilogies on the Tolkien fandom. This month's column focuses on the fanfiction fandom and uses data from the Tolkien Fanfiction Survey to consider the question of initiation: How the films brought fans to the fic fandom and the kinds of stories those fans wrote once they arrived.

Of course, it's impossible to discuss this topic right now without considering the upcoming Rings of Power television series—and in fact, this series is deliberately timed as discussions about how the show will impact the fandom become increasingly common. As the title of this inaugural article suggests, the main impact of the films on the fic fandom has been to drive fans toward the books, helping to create the very book-centric Tolkien fic fandom we all enjoy today—part of the reason, in fact, that you are reading this now!

Arda on Ice (Volume 17, Issue 3)

This week, we introduce our March 2022 challenge, Arda on Ice. While inspired by figure skating, it most definitely doesn't require you to use, mention, or even know anything at all about figure skating! This makes this a good challenge to illustrate our approach to challenges, which have been a part of the SWG since September 2005, when we introduced challenges with our Strong Women challenge. Since then we've offered over one hundred challenges.

When we design the challenges, we aim for maximum inclusivity. We do not want to exclude creators by forcing them to create about a specific character or other canon element or create a specific format of fanwork. That doesn't mean that every creator will like every challenge format, but we never want a creator to skip a challenge because it focuses only on Elves and they write about Dwarves, or because it requires poetry when they're a graphic artist.

Arda on Ice is an illustration of that. Creators choose three to eight very broad prompts to use in a fanwork. Those who know figure skating will pick up on the fact that the prompts are inspired by the figure skating moves. Those who don't know figure skating can pick the prompts they think work well together and never think about skating at all!

As the SWG expands to welcome all fanworks and not just writing, our moderator team is working on making sure our challenges and other site documents are maximally inclusive of all creators. The Return of the Newsletter (Volume 17, Issue 1)

In crafting titles, Tolkien loved returns. There's The Return of the King, "Of the Return of the Noldor," and The Return of the Shadow. As we mark the occasion of relaunching our newsletter, it seems appropriate to title this first new edition "The Return of the Newsletter"!

Our newsletter is older than our archive. The first edition was posted in September 2005, and we did not miss a month until April 2021, when our new site made the old newsletter format redundant. With this "Return of the Newsletter," we will be introducing a new format: a weekly email round-up of new and updated fanworks, SWG news, and announcements from around the fandom. We're also working on adding more original content to our newsletter, with feature articles and columns (including the return of the Character of the Month!)
